Subject:Re: [PDO] [RFC] An Idea for PDO 2

Lukas Kahwe Smith wrote:
 >> What other extensions have been written using an external (to PHP)
 >> specification?
 >
 > You are missing the point here. A document that all drivers are expected
 > to follow needs to be CLA free or it has no chance of being accepted at
 > php.net. After all SQLite, MySQL, PostgreSQL, Firebird and friends would
 > also be expected to follow those specs.

MySQL have stated that they will follow what the PHP community
accepts, whether or not that includes a CLA.

What I was questioning was whether all current PECL extensions
implement PHP-only specifications.  Since we already have extensions
that implement externally established specifications (e.g. XML-RPC),
then what is special about PDO (assuming no shared core PDO extension)
that would require the spec to be CLA-free?

I'm just trying to explore the options here.
